How many watts solar panel Do I need to charge 12V battery?

How many watts solar panel Do I need to charge 12V battery?

Charging your battery at 12 volts and 20 amps will take five hours to charge a 100 amp hour battery. By multiplying 20 amps by 12 volts, 240 watts is how big of a panel you would need, so we’d recommend using a 300w solar panel or 3 100 watt solar panels. Can a 24v solar charge a 12V battery?

Yes, you could do it. They are usually designed to put out at least 30\% more than the batteries they are intended to charge. This works perfectly well because a PV module is (at a constant light level) a constant current device.

How many amps does a 12V solar panel produce?

When a 12V solar panel is rated at 100W, that is an instantaneous voltage rating. So if all of the test conditions are met, when you measure the output, the voltage will be about 18 volts. Since watts equals volts times amps, amperage will be equal to 5.5 amps (100 watts divided by 18 volts) . So your panel will produce 5.5 amps per hour.

How much sunlight do I need to charge 12v200ah battery?

You have at least 6 hours of peak sunlight available. First we want to see how much power do we require to charge the battery. 12V200Ah can also be written as 12V*200Ah = 2400WHr or 2.4KWHr. Since we assumed that battery is at 10\% level it means that we have to charge 2400WHr * 90\% = 2160WHr
